The Mecklenburg Math Club
was founded in 1990 by Dr. Harold Reiter. It was begun to provide enrichment
and challenges for students in the fourth, fifth, and sixth grades who have a
strong interest and ability in mathematics. The club meets once a month during
the months spanning September to May. At club meetings students participate in
the Math Olympiad for Elementary and Middle Schools. For the 2006-2007
